DJ Khaled Debuts At #1 on Billboard Top 200 With ‘Khaled Khaled’

Returning to the top once again, DJ Khaled earns his third #1 debut on the Billboard Top 200 with the biggest hip-hop event of the summer and his twelfth full-length album, KHALED KHALED [We The Best Music Group/Epic Records]. Additionally, it marks his sixth #1 on the Top Rap Albums Chart and fourth #1 on the R&B/Hip-Hop Albums Chart. Notably, the record has already amassed over 1 billion streams and counting.

This latest achievement follows a string of major milestones as accredited by the RIAA. Recently, Khaled’s classic anthem “Wild Thoughts” [feat. Rihanna & Bryson Tiller] just received a 6x-platinum certification. He also has now garnered a staggering 37 digital single awards, while his total career single sales surpass 40 million-plus.

ABOUT DJ KHALED:

For over two decades, the very mention of DJ Khaled has implied an elevated level of musical greatness, entrepreneurial excellence, and cultural impact. You’ve heard him across a GRAMMY® Award-winning multiplatinum catalog, seen him in blockbusters such as Bad Boys For Life, caught him on the cover of Rolling Stone, watched him on numerous television programs, and felt his presence from the streets all the way up to the Barack Obama White House. He has achieved dozens of multiplatinum and gold certifications, including the sextuple-platinum Billboard Hot 100 #1 “I’m The One” [feat. Justin BieberQuavoChance the Rapper, & Lil Wayne], quadruple-platinum “Wild Thoughts” [feat. Rihanna Bryson Tiller], and double-platinum “No Brainer” [feat. Justin BieberChance the Rapper, & Quavo]. The latter propelled his 2019 album, Father of Asahd [We The Best Music Group/Epic Records], to the top of the charts. Not only did it garner a platinum certification, but it also became his third consecutive Top 2 debut on the Billboard Top 200 and emerged as the “#1 Most-Streamed Record” upon release. To date, he has moved 20 million singles and 6 million albums in addition to gathering 4 billion-plus streams.

Not to mention, he launched We The Best Music Group—a record label, management, publishing, and production company and in-demand studio. As a committed philanthropist, he founded his 501(c)3 organization The We The Best Foundation. It uplifts individuals throughout underserved communities across the United States and supports various non-profits.
